There are different types of industrial water treatment chemicals that are used depending on the specific needs of the industry. Some common types of chemicals used in water treatment include coagulants, flocculants, disinfectants, pH adjusters, and corrosion inhibitors. Each of these chemicals plays a specific role in the treatment process and helps to achieve the desired water quality.

Coagulants are chemicals that are used to destabilize the particles in water, allowing them to come together and form larger particles. This makes it easier for the particles to be removed from the water through filtration or settling processes. Flocculants, on the other hand, are chemicals that help to clump together the larger particles that have formed, making them easier to remove from the water.

Disinfectants are chemicals that are used to kill or inactivate harmful microorganisms such as bacteria, viruses, and protozoa that may be present in the water. Common disinfectants used in industrial water treatment include chlorine, ozone, and UV light. These chemicals help to ensure that the water is free from harmful pathogens and safe for use.

pH adjusters are chemicals that are used to regulate the pH level of water. The pH level of water can have a significant impact on its quality and suitability for use in different industrial processes. By adjusting the pH level of water, industries can ensure that the water is not too acidic or basic, and meets the requirements for its specific application.

Corrosion inhibitors are chemicals that are used to prevent the corrosion of metal pipes and equipment that come into contact with water. Corrosion can cause damage to industrial equipment and infrastructure, leading to costly repairs and downtime. By using corrosion inhibitors, industries can protect their assets and extend the lifespan of their equipment.

In addition to these commonly used chemicals, there are also specialty chemicals that are used for specific applications in industrial water treatment. These chemicals are designed to target specific contaminants or address unique challenges faced by industries. Some examples of specialty chemicals include scale inhibitors, antifoaming agents, and desalination chemicals.
